    You obviously not insulting the enemy enough. Seriously though I haven't had this problem. Everyone loves beating Maxy up. If you are having problems controlling aggro its probably down to either 2 things. You are not taunting the enemy or you team mates are targeting the wrong ppl, maybe another mob or something.

    Tell you team mates to go for a particular enemy e.g. boss and make sure you taunting him and starting hitting other enemies or get team mates to target the enemies through nominated person (doesn't have to be you). That should allow you to control the aggro abit better.

    P.S. By the way, you say baddies pick on the squishies. Had a particular squishy decided to fire off a Nova by any chance and then find themselves surprised they are number one target?

    Hmmm, not sure I totally agree with that (although I'm just assuming you are talking about the early levels?). Playing an empath has given me a much better understanding of what I put healers through when I play my other alts. I would agree that having one healing target is good, however tanks in the early levels can't hold agro and can't take huge amounts of damage anyway. I much prefer Fort'ing the tank and knowing he is fairly safe for a while as it leaves me free to focus on the real squishies (where one hit sends them into the red). If the tank goes in first, gauntlet will ensure they have all the aggro they can cope with without having to use taunt. I built an empath purely for healing and if the damage comes in too fast I still can't cope. I'm not sure how those healers that take a lot of their secondary would cope with a tank that had all the aggro on him...?

    As for soloing with a tank, I never could (or at least it was too dull). If you build a scranker, they aren't good on a team but if you build a team tank, they can't really solo. Fire tanks were one of the few exceptions to that, not sure they still are? If you want to solo, a tank is really not the way to go. Well, that's just my opinion anyway.
